Eleazar Lipa Sukenik. Megilot Gnuzot. illust., dedication, 1950, 91pp., 31.5x24 cm. wear, rubbing, staining to cover, foxing stains to end papers, minimal inside,
Scrolls hidden from ancient Geniza found in the Judean Desert Second review Elazar Lipa Sukenik Large format
Eleazar Lipa Sukenik (12 August 1889, Białystok – 28 February 1953, Jerusalem) was an Israeli archaeologist and professor at the Hebrew University of Jerusalem. He is best known for helping establish the Department of Archaeology at Hebrew University and being one of the first academics recognizing the age and importance of the Dead Sea Scrolls. He also oversaw the uncovering of the Third Wall in Jerusalem. He also was the director of the Museum of Jewish Antiquities.
